Johnny Gill Jr. is a well-known American singer and composer who was born on May 22, 1966.

He is the sixth and final member of the R&B/pop group New Edition and a member of the supergroup called LSG alongside Gerald Levert and Keith Sweat.

He has released eight albums under his own name, three albums under the name New Edition, two albums under the name LSG, and one album in collaboration with Stacy Lattisaw. As a solo artist, Gill has sold more than 15 million copies internationally.

Gill was born to Johnny Gill Sr., a Baptist pastor, and his wife, Annie Mae Gill. He was the fourth of their four sons.

Gill began singing in a family gospel group called “Little Johnny and Wings of Faith” when he was just five years old.

He performed in churches from a young age. During his academic career, he attended Kimball Elementary, Sousa Junior High, and Duke Ellington School of the Arts.

Due to the demands of his profession, he had to finish his high school education with the help of a tutor. Although he had initially intended to pursue a degree in electrical engineering, he eventually chose to focus on his singing career.

Gill has appeared in over 80 different movies and television shows as a musician and actor.

He sang “You For Me” in the film Madea’s Family Reunion, which was released in 2006.

He also appeared in an episode of the television show Family Matters. Alongside Robin Givens, Shirley Murdock, and Jermaine Crawford, Gill was one of the starring actors in the stage production of A Mother’s Prayer in 2009.
